The best neighborhoods in Playa del Ingles (Gran Canaria) to stay in
The most popular neighborhoods to stay in Playa del Ingles are San Agustin and Maspalomas. San Agustin offers a quieter and more relaxed atmosphere, perfect for those seeking a peaceful retreat, while Maspalomas is known for its beautiful sand dunes and vibrant nightlife, making it an ideal choice for those looking for entertainment and excitement.
